- [ ] **Step 7: Breaker override escrow.** After sealing the signing keys for the Tallgrove upstream API circuit breaker, confirm the support team can force the breaker open during a full outage. The override bundle lives in the sealed escrow drawer and is useless without its unlock phrase. Two ceremony witnesses must initial this step before proceeding. The escrow bundle is decrypted with the recovery passphrase that follows.

vault phrase of kahip-kahop = holath-quenmir

**Ticket: CSV import wizard chokes on quoted commas**

The Fernbright import wizard splits fields on every comma, even inside quotes, so Marisol's vendor file from Dalewick landed with 900 mangled rows. Looks like the parser regression from the streaming rewrite. Repro is trivial: any quoted address field breaks. Flagging for the weekly sync since it blocks the Orvanna onboarding. The affected build is noted right below.

session token of bawep-yadup = htk21_528abd376e3c5a4ec24a1

Meeting notes — Onboarding sync, Fennwick Data Platform

Covered the retention sweeper (`sweep-expired`): runs nightly, deletes records past their policy window, and writes a tombstone log for audit. Contractors must never run it against the Harlow staging cluster manually. Dry-run mode is mandatory before any config change. If the sweeper halts or the tombstone counts look wrong, escalate directly to the engineer listed below.

named custodian: Brivan Eliath Quenox Frador

Hi team — handing over release duties for the week. Main thing on Velting's orphaned-resource sweeper: the dry-run flag is still on in prod, so nothing's actually being deleted yet. Flip it Thursday after the capacity review. Deploys go through the usual pipeline, nothing weird. For the sweeper's deploy step you'll need this, pasted below.

signing key of bagap-yawep = bky13_TbfT6ZMUoGJo2

## Add static-analysis baseline for the Thornbury plugin API

This change introduces a checked-in baseline file so existing findings in Thornbury core do not block external plugin builds. New findings introduced by a plugin will still fail CI; only pre-existing ones are suppressed. The baseline is regenerated weekly and never edited by hand. Enforcement behavior is governed by the thresholds listed below.

constants for bawif-kawif:
QUOTAS = {
    "ulaael": 5,
    "holael": 10,
}